{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":749146640,"defaultBranch":"main","name":"ML-Engineering-Demo","ownerLogin":"natannvw","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2024-01-27T18:03:46.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/69158504?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1706768260.0","currentOid":""},"activityList":{"items":[{"before":"2082ff060825cbd68e9382e6a0cdb4f954475fd4","after":"8c78b54beb433d5726036e84d0ce8153625b7ac3","ref":"refs/heads/main","pushedAt":"2024-03-24T06:43: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"0e18d22ec848cbf8905658fd69a6d2ff65a0f508","after":"2082ff060825cbd68e9382e6a0cdb4f954475fd4","ref":"refs/heads/main","pushedAt":"2024-03-24T06:41:47.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Create requirements.txt","shortMessageHtmlLink":"Create requirements.txt"}},{"before":"7bc4ebff2f81e3fdcb011e374403098dc6ffe04e","after":"0e18d22ec848cbf8905658fd69a6d2ff65a0f508","ref":"refs/heads/main","pushedAt":"2024-02-03T13:44:49.000Z","pushType":"pr_merge","commitsCount":34,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Merge pull request #2 from natannvw/mlflow-integration\n\nMlflow integration plus Ray implementation","shortMessageHtmlLink":"Merge pull request #2 from natannvw/mlflow-integration"}},{"before":"e86145769a69b6424bcde289bf46e15b3d1bd66b","after":"1c929388b4f312fcb3f5d692a4415c81ad80aea2","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-03T13:43:30.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update ml_pipeline.py","shortMessageHtmlLink":"Update ml_pipeline.py"}},{"before":"89444d3ef7ca3563090570fe0ae0e63cc6ac7979","after":"e86145769a69b6424bcde289bf46e15b3d1bd66b","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-03T13:42:42.000Z","pushType":"push","commitsCount":4,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update submission.csv","shortMessageHtmlLink":"Update submission.csv"}},{"before":"b72961257fd67dc07d077f077e6c6904b90336fa","after":"89444d3ef7ca3563090570fe0ae0e63cc6ac7979","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-03T13:28:12.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"bug fix at predict_pipeline()\n\nValueError: The feature names should match those that were passed during fit.","shortMessageHtmlLink":"bug fix at predict_pipeline()"}},{"before":"42cf4b52665423fa1d079234b9d4f29f168f1d44","after":"b72961257fd67dc07d077f077e6c6904b90336fa","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-03T11:39:36.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update model_training.py","shortMessageHtmlLink":"Update model_training.py"}},{"before":"aa4aa037c653bfaf994c4c7c6fa618490818ac31","after":"42cf4b52665423fa1d079234b9d4f29f168f1d44","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-03T11:33:40.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update ml_pipeline.py","shortMessageHtmlLink":"Update ml_pipeline.py"}},{"before":"1648cb41db43256575da3850bbe19696b943b807","after":"aa4aa037c653bfaf994c4c7c6fa618490818ac31","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-03T11:24:45.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"int cols to float","shortMessageHtmlLink":"int cols to float"}},{"before":"840d4a91d443866113875cf2230e54299285121d","after":"1648cb41db43256575da3850bbe19696b943b807","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-03T10:16: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"implement tqdm to the ray process","shortMessageHtmlLink":"implement tqdm to the ray process"}},{"before":"2c56454acc9d0cabdcfef2eff1cc9bcebcf94339","after":"840d4a91d443866113875cf2230e54299285121d","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-03T10:07:03.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"mlflow.sklearn.autolog(log_models=False)","shortMessageHtmlLink":"mlflow.sklearn.autolog(log_models=False)"}},{"before":"cd160a1ade4621a8fcc2f1a22e61cbe86213d6d1","after":"2c56454acc9d0cabdcfef2eff1cc9bcebcf94339","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-02T22:16:04.000Z","pushType":"push","commitsCount":5,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"create and finish register_best_model()","shortMessageHtmlLink":"create and finish register_best_model()"}},{"before":"780beaf03e558bc1ea72b5d83a53b32af062e271","after":"cd160a1ade4621a8fcc2f1a22e61cbe86213d6d1","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-02T17:09:48.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"get_finished_configs()","shortMessageHtmlLink":"get_finished_configs()"}},{"before":"5f56220485ced4a330ed1648e223356142f36939","after":"780beaf03e558bc1ea72b5d83a53b32af062e271","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-02T16:21:13.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"parallelism with ray","shortMessageHtmlLink":"parallelism with ray"}},{"before":"3cb34c60644fdc0e93e4b4ef1189675378b3e5ed","after":"5f56220485ced4a330ed1648e223356142f36939","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-02T15:24: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"features_selection() and first test run checked","shortMessageHtmlLink":"features_selection() and first test run checked"}},{"before":"8ba056cf42b10913f8a7e594a6c5f41f854ad070","after":"3cb34c60644fdc0e93e4b4ef1189675378b3e5ed","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-02T15:10: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"update ml_pipeline()","shortMessageHtmlLink":"update ml_pipeline()"}},{"before":"254e9110da7a59fcb1c197ac916aade545d3f6b0","after":"8ba056cf42b10913f8a7e594a6c5f41f854ad070","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-02T15:08: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"added type hints","shortMessageHtmlLink":"added type hints"}},{"before":"937b74b8247b579245d69cb3fa4e5909bf959250","after":"254e9110da7a59fcb1c197ac916aade545d3f6b0","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-02T14:56:47.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update mlflow_utils.py","shortMessageHtmlLink":"Update mlflow_utils.py"}},{"before":"b72e36707ce321127a1153d5820def5d358bf63b","after":"937b74b8247b579245d69cb3fa4e5909bf959250","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-01T07:29:30.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"set up mlflow server and experiment","shortMessageHtmlLink":"set up mlflow server and experiment"}},{"before":"7bc4ebff2f81e3fdcb011e374403098dc6ffe04e","after":"b72e36707ce321127a1153d5820def5d358bf63b","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-01T06:41:04.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Create mlflow_utils.py","shortMessageHtmlLink":"Create mlflow_utils.py"}},{"before":null,"after":"7bc4ebff2f81e3fdcb011e374403098dc6ffe04e","ref":"refs/heads/mlflow-integration","pushedAt":"2024-02-01T06:17:40.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"comment: Avoid data leakage by fitting the scaler on the training data only","shortMessageHtmlLink":"comment: Avoid data leakage by fitting the scaler on the training dat…"}},{"before":"5374e8e30b8e3876509639a1c4ea6c7ee02991b3","after":"7bc4ebff2f81e3fdcb011e374403098dc6ffe04e","ref":"refs/heads/main","pushedAt":"2024-01-31T20:20: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"comment: Avoid data leakage by fitting the scaler on the training data only","shortMessageHtmlLink":"comment: Avoid data leakage by fitting the scaler on the training dat…"}},{"before":"661dc28b6929fe2db4b1d6ee95eeaa7c4de2cf67","after":"5374e8e30b8e3876509639a1c4ea6c7ee02991b3","ref":"refs/heads/main","pushedAt":"2024-01-31T16:46:46.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update README.md","shortMessageHtmlLink":"Update README.md"}},{"before":"5e695d0db86fc5b5203f99c2ed321147a4363efd","after":"661dc28b6929fe2db4b1d6ee95eeaa7c4de2cf67","ref":"refs/heads/main","pushedAt":"2024-01-31T16:36:57.000Z","pushType":"pr_merge","commitsCount":9,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Merge pull request #1 from natannvw/cominations-implementation\n\nCominations implementation","shortMessageHtmlLink":"Merge pull request #1 from natannvw/cominations-implementation"}},{"before":"998e2bf4f5b0a4ad806a567c660f86206b00716e","after":"d873a08b3cd0870eed61f42475766a53de4923d9","ref":"refs/heads/cominations-implementation","pushedAt":"2024-01-31T16:35:32.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update ml_pipeline.py","shortMessageHtmlLink":"Update ml_pipeline.py"}},{"before":"cc9504a944c9416f36663a121ed02d32f2b0b6bc","after":"998e2bf4f5b0a4ad806a567c660f86206b00716e","ref":"refs/heads/cominations-implementation","pushedAt":"2024-01-31T16:34: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"remove powerset()","shortMessageHtmlLink":"remove powerset()"}},{"before":"5e695d0db86fc5b5203f99c2ed321147a4363efd","after":"cc9504a944c9416f36663a121ed02d32f2b0b6bc","ref":"refs/heads/cominations-implementation","pushedAt":"2024-01-31T16:33:32.000Z","pushType":"push","commitsCount":6,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Update ml_pipeline.py","shortMessageHtmlLink":"Update ml_pipeline.py"}},{"before":null,"after":"5e695d0db86fc5b5203f99c2ed321147a4363efd","ref":"refs/heads/cominations-implementation","pushedAt":"2024-01-31T15:46:02.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"robust ml_pipeline by separation to ml and predic pipelines","shortMessageHtmlLink":"robust ml_pipeline by separation to ml and predic pipelines"}},{"before":"1b26fadd5bd4854d63f54b74e9fb32d03a713bb9","after":"5e695d0db86fc5b5203f99c2ed321147a4363efd","ref":"refs/heads/main","pushedAt":"2024-01-31T15:45:37.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"robust ml_pipeline by separation to ml and predic pipelines","shortMessageHtmlLink":"robust ml_pipeline by separation to ml and predic pipelines"}},{"before":"3f81c26aa6ba89d589cac07e27b45dde9f4c3434","after":"1b26fadd5bd4854d63f54b74e9fb32d03a713bb9","ref":"refs/heads/main","pushedAt":"2024-01-31T15:33:42.000Z","pushType":"push","commitsCount":3,"pusher":{"login":"natannvw","name":null,"path":"/natannvw","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/69158504?s=80&v=4"},"commit":{"message":"Delete run.ipynb","shortMessageHtmlLink":"Delete run.ipynb"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yNC0wMy0yNFQwNjo0MzowMi4wMDAwMDBazwAAAAQdwePu","startC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wMy0yNFQwNjo0MzowMi4wMDAwMDBazwAAAAQdwePu","endC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wMS0zMVQxNTozMzo0Mi4wMDAwMDBazwAAAAPuMWNY"}},"title":"Activity · natannvw/ML-Engineering-Demo"}